Healing with Heart: Richard Zombeck on Recovery Coaching

I see that as a commonality amongst alcoholics and addicts that you can treat me like a dirt bag, all you want. So you're not hurting me, but if you show me a little bit of compassion and kindness, that's going to disarm me, because I don't know how to deal with that, and that hurts right.
Imagine facing addiction not just with medical treatments, but with genuine compassion and understanding. In this eye-opening episode of 'Collateral Damage', hosts Maureen Cavanagh and Michael Wilson sit down with Richard Zombeck, an Addictions Recovery Coach and Peer Support Supervisor. Richard brings his wealth of experience to the table, shedding light on the often-overlooked emotional aspects of recovery coaching.
Richard emphasizes that the language we use around addiction matters, but what truly makes a difference is focusing on the individual's needs. It's about listening, understanding, and crafting a recovery plan that truly fits the person. He shares compelling stories that illustrate how kindness and empathy can break down barriers for those struggling with substance use.
The episode dives into the goals of recovery coaching, such as helping individuals recognize their strengths and challenges, setting achievable goals, and providing ongoing support. Richard's approach is all about empowering people to take control of their recovery journey. But it’s not just about the technicalities of coaching. The conversation also touches on the broader landscape of addiction beyond just opiates—covering substances like alcohol, crystal meth, cocaine, and benzos.
The trio discusses the need for a holistic approach that addresses the complex nature of substance use disorders. What makes this episode truly special are the heartfelt stories of hope and recovery. Richard, Maureen, and Michael paint a vivid picture of what compassionate addiction treatment looks like, showing that with the right support, recovery is possible. Whether you're personally affected by addiction or looking to understand it better, this episode offers valuable insights and a touch of optimism.
